Thalassoma bifasciatum, the bluehead, bluehead wrasse or blue-headed wrasse, is a species of marine ray-finned fish, a wrasse from the family Labridae.It is native to the coral reefs of the tropical waters of the western Atlantic Ocean.Individuals are small (less than 110 mm standard length) and rarely live longer than two years. An initial caging experiment demonstrated that juvenile bluehead wrasse settlers suffer high predation, and spatial settlement patterns indicated that bluehead wrasse juveniles preferentially settle in groups, although they are also found singly. Juvenile blue-headed wrasse predominantly feed on benthic organisms (Feddern, 1965) and so it is hypothesised that if cleaning does provide a compulsory component of their diet, the foraging rate of individual wrasse on the substrate would be negatively influenced by their respective cleaning rates. Start studying WSORC Juvenile Fish Species (Made by staff). Juveniles and initial phase individuals in particular may participate in cleaning stations, consuming dead material and parasites off of the bodies and out of the gills of larger fish as they pass through the station. Juvenile blue-headed wrasse are generalist foragers, and may thus be limited in their cleaning behaviour by their nutritional requirements, the availability of a suitable cleaning site, and fish density, which ultimately means that they do not adopt more dedicated cleaning roles within the reef community. Diet / Feeding Diet consists of zooplankton, small benthic organisms, eggs of small fish species (saddle blenny, beaugregory damselfish and sergeant majors) and ectoparasites and dead tissue from fish at cleaning stations.
